Port in NE England, at the mouth of the
Tweed, Northumberland, 5 km/3 mi SE of the
Scottish border; population (1991) 27,230.
It is a fishing port. Other industries
include iron foundries and shipbuilding.
features Three bridges cross the Tweed:
the Old Bridge 1611-34 with 15 arches, the
Royal Border railway bridge 1850
constructed by Robert Stephenson, and the
Royal Tweed Bridge 1928. history Held
alternately by England and Scotland for
centuries, Berwick was in 1551 made a neutral
town; it was attached to Northumberland in
1885.
